# Configure Service Nginx
A GitHub Action that pushes a Magento-aware nginx configuration into an **already-running nginx service container**, reloads it, and waits for the container's healthcheck to pass.
The action does **not** start nginx. It assumes the calling workflow declared nginx as a `services:` container (typically alongside `php-fpm`, and other mandatory Magento services).
The shipped `default.conf` is a thin outer wrapper that defines a `fastcgi_backend` upstream pointing at `php-fpm:9000`, sets `$MAGE_ROOT`, and includes Magento's own `nginx.conf.sample` from your own Magento install. All real routing rules come from Magento's bundled file.
## When to use this
Use this action when you have a workflow that:
1. Boots nginx as `services:` containers with the workspace bind-mounted at `/var/www/html`, and
2. Wants those containers to actually serve a Magento store you've already installed into the workspace (e.g. for end-to-end smoke tests, integration tests, or any HTTP-driven check).
You do **not** need this action if:
- You're not running nginx at all (unit tests, coding standards, static analysis).
- nginx is started by something other than a GitHub Actions `services:` block
- You've already configured nginx some other way and don't need a Magento-ready outer config.
## Prerequisites
- An nginx service container is running on the same Docker host as the runner, with an image matching the `image` input.
- A `php-fpm` container, the included `default.conf` will set up a fast-cgi backend to `php-fpm:9000`.
- The runner's workspace (`$GITHUB_WORKSPACE`) is bind-mounted into the nginx container at `/var/www/html`.
- A Magento install exists at `${{ inputs.magento_path }}` relative to the workspace, with `nginx.conf.sample` present (it ships with Magento by default after `composer install`).
## Inputs
| Input | Required | Default | Description |
| ------------------------ | -------- | ------- | ---------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- |
| `container_id` | Yes | — | The ID of the running nginx service container. Pass `${{ job.services.nginx.id }}` (replace `nginx` with whatever you named the service). |
| `magento_path` | No | `.` | Path to the Magento store, relative to the GitHub workspace. Combined with the `/var/www/html` mount prefix to compute the in-container `MAGE_ROOT`. |
| `health_timeout_seconds` | No | `10` | How long to wait for nginx to report `healthy` after the config is pushed and the container restarts. |
